FAQ

What is Timken's D&A?
Timken (TKR) reported D&A of $58.9M in Q1 2026.
How has Timken's D&A changed year-over-year?
Timken's D&A increased by 6.9% year-over-year, from $55.1M to $58.9M.
What is the long-term trend for Timken's D&A?
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Timken's D&A has grown at a 8.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$167.8M to $230.1M.
What does D&A mean?
Total non-cash depreciation of tangible assets and amortization of intangible assets — the largest add-back to net income in the operating cash flow reconciliation.
